  • Lady Gaga Performs “Abracadabra” & “Killah” on Saturday Night Live

  • American singer-songwriter Lady Gaga appeared on Saturday Night Live to perform “Abracadabra” and “Killah”.


    This marks her first musical guest on Saturday Night Live in nine years since 2016.
    Two songs are featured on her latest album “MAYHEM”, which was released on March 7, 2025.
    “Abracadabra” was released as the second single from the album last month. It was produced by Lady Gaga, Andrew Watt, and Cirkut.

    Lady Gaga told Apple Music about “Abracadabra”, “I think I didn't want to make this kind of music for a long time, even though I had it in me. And I think 'Abracadabra' is very much my sound-something that I honed in [on] after many years, and I wanted to do it again. I felt like being stagnant was just death in my artistry. And I just really wanted to constantly be a student. Not just reinvent myself, but learn something new with every record. And that wasn't always what people wanted from me, but that's what I wanted from me. And it's the thing that I'm the most probably proud of, if I look back on my career, is I know how much I grew from record to record and how authentic it all was. The thing that was most important to me was being a student of music, above everything else.”
  • On the album, “Killah” features French DJ Gesaffelstein. It was produced by Lady Gaga, Gesaffelstein, Andrew Watt, and Cirkut.
    This time, she performed the song as a solo act.

    Lady Gaga told Rolling Stone about “Killah”, “Probably 'Killah.' I love the production on it so much. The only live instrument on the whole record is a guitar, and it is just so much fun. It is so confident. But it was unlike any feel or groove that I'd ever worked on before. And also the truth is, I'm not that confident all the time. I'm someone who definitely can feel deeply insecure, but on that record, it's like peak confidence. And that's part of the journey of Mayhem as one night out. If you think of the album as one whole night, it's like that moment in the night when you're just feeling your best.”
